In this work a multirate digital control scheme for an ε nonminimum phase systems is proposed and the case study of a PVTOL aircraft model is developed. Considering the nominal plant, it is firstly shown, on the basis of an exact sampled dynamics can be obtained under preliminary feedback and diffeomorphism, that an exact dead beat control scheme can be designed. This method is the same as the one proposed in [7], concerning digital control of nonholonomic systems. To reduce the effects of the perturbation parameter ε a control scheme, which allows to take into account this effect up to a desired fixed order of approximation, is proposed. In this paper, for computational reasons, only the first order of approximation is considered. Simulation results comparing previous continuous time control schemes and the present digital one are given.
